当前位置: 首页 > news >正文

网站 框架wordpress添加登入

网站 框架,wordpress添加登入,穿山甲广告联盟,外贸网站开发推广目录前言#xff1a;1、结构化查询语言(Structured Query Language)简称SQL。2、基本SELECT语句语法3、多表链接4、笛卡尔积5、ANSI SQL ANSI SQL#xff1a;1999标准的连接语法6、单行函数和分组函数的区别#xff1a;7、分组函数8、SQL语句的执行顺序#xff1a;9、子查询…目录前言1、结构化查询语言(Structured Query Language)简称SQL。2、基本SELECT语句语法3、多表链接4、笛卡尔积5、ANSI SQL ANSI SQL1999标准的连接语法6、单行函数和分组函数的区别7、分组函数8、SQL语句的执行顺序9、子查询10、Data Manipulation Language ,简称DML主要用来实现对 数据库表中的数据进行操作11、多行子查询总结 目录 前言 最近由于工作需要把数据库的知识复习了一遍。以下是自己总结的一些个人认为比较重要的知识点有些是个人不太熟的知识点就记下来当笔记吧如有不足或错误请大家及时指出。 1、结构化查询语言(Structured Query Language)简称SQL。 2、基本SELECT语句语法 SELECT [DISTINCT]{ |column|expression [alias],...} FROM table; 3、多表链接 连接是在多个表之间通过 定的连接条件 连接是在多个表之间通过一定的连接条件使表之间发生关联进而能从多个表之间获取数据。 N个表相连时至少需要N1个连接条件 4、笛卡尔积 第一个表中的所有行和第二个表中的所有行都发生连接。 笛卡尔积的写法 SQL SELECT emp.empno, emp.ename, emp.deptno, 2 dept.deptno, dept.loc 3 FROM emp, d t ep ; 5、ANSI SQL ANSI SQL1999标准的连接语法 SELECT table1.column, table2.column FROM table1 [CROSS JOIN table2] | [NATURAL JOIN table2] | [JOIN table2 USING ( USING (column name column_name)] | [JOIN table2 ON(table1.column_name table2.column_name)] | [LEFT|RIGHT|FULL OUTER JOIN [LEFT|RIGHT|FULL OUTER JOIN table2 ON (table1.column_name table2.column_name)]; 6、单行函数和分组函数的区别 7、分组函数 – 分组函数是对表中一组记录进行操作每组只返回一个结果即首先要对表记录进行分组然后再进行操作汇总 每组返回一个结果分组时可能是整个表分为一组也可能根据条件分成多组。 分组函数常用到以下五个函数 • MIN • MAX • SUM • AVG • COUNT 常用的语法格式 SELECT [column,] group_function(column) FROM tab el [WHERE condition] [GROUP BY column] [HAVING group_function(column)expression [ORDER BY column| group_function(column)expression]; 一些错误案例 8、SQL语句的执行顺序 SELECT语句执行过程 – 1.通过FROM子句中找到需要查询的表 子句中找到需要查询的表 – 2.通过WHERE子句进行非分组函数筛选判断 – 3.通过GROUP BY子句完成分组操作 – 4.通过HAVING子句完成组函数筛选判断 – 5.通过SELECT子句选择显示的列或表达式及组函数 – 6.通过ORDER BY子句进行排序操作。 案例 9、子查询 子查询语法 SELECT select_list FROM table WHERE expr operator (SELECT select_list FROM table); • 括号内的查询叫做子查询也叫内部查询先于主查询执行。 • 子查询的结果被主查询外部查询使用 • expr operator包括比较运算符。 –单行运算符、、、、、 –多行运算符 IN、ANY、ALL • 子查询可以嵌于以下SQL子句中 –WHERE子句 –HAVING子句 –FROM子句 • 子查询使用指导 –子查询要用括号括起来 –将子查询放在比较运算符的右边 –对于单行子查询要使用单行运算符 单行子查询是针对子查询的返回值只有一个 –对于多行查询要使用多行运算符 错误案例子查询中使用分组函数返回多个结果 10、Data Manipulation Language ,简称DML主要用来实现对 数据库表中的数据进行操作 索引( INDEX ): – 是对数据库表中一个或多个列的值进行排序的一种数据库对象。 – 在数据库中,通过索引可以加速对表的查询速度; 索引缺点 • 占用空间 • 降低DML的操作速度 适合创建索引情况 • 表数据量很大 • 要查询的结果集在2%-4%左右 • 经常用来做WHERE条件中的列或者多表连接的列 • 查询列的数据范围分布很广 • 查询列中包含大量的NULL值,因为空值不包含在索引中 不适合创建索引情况 • 数据量很小的表 • 在查询中不常用来作为查询条件的列 • 频繁更新的表 • 索引列作为表达式的一部分被使用时比如常查询的条件是SALARY*12 SALARY*12此时在SALARY列上创建索引是没有效果的 • 查询条件中有单行函数时用不上索引。 11、多行子查询 –子查询返回记录的条数 可以是一条或多条。 –和多行子查询进行比较时需要使用多行操作符多行操作符包括 • IN • ANY • ALL –IN操作符和以前介绍的功能一致判断是否与子查询 的任意一个返回值相同。单行子查询操作符不能接子查询中含有分组函数执行语句的情况 ANY的使用 – ANY表示和子查询的任意一行结果进行比较有一个满足 条件即可。 • ANY表示小于子查询结果集中的任意 表示小于子查询结果集中的任意一个 即小于最 大值就可以。 • ANY表示大于子查询结果集 个 中的任意一 即大于最小值就可以。 • ANY表示等于子查询结果中的任意一个即等于谁都 可以相当于IN。 • ALL的使用 – ALL表示和子查询的所有行结果进行比较每一行必须都 满足条件。 • ALL:表示小于子查询结果集中的所有行 表示小于子查询结果集中的所有行即小于最小 值。 • ALL:表示大于子查询结果集 行 中的所有 即大于最大 值。 • ALL :表示等于子查询结果集中的所有行,即等于所有值通常无意义。 总结 SQL这块需要掌握以下这些知识点 掌握单表查询、多表查询、分组、子查询等查询方法能写出相对复杂的查询语句重点中的重点。掌握Oracle数据库常用的单行函数及分组函数。掌握插入数据、修改数据、删除数据语句。 总结成一句话就是能够利用SQL进行数据分析就OK了。 除此之外还需要了解一些相关的数据库概念。这里就不一一列举了。如果各位网友看完之后想练下手含有各种版本数据库的建表数据和对应的案例练习题以及答案 请参考https://blog.csdn.net/qq_16633405/article/details/78483269
http://wiki.neutronadmin.com/news/143972/

相关文章:

  • 做贸易选哪家网站京美建站官网
  • 谷歌云 阿里云 做网站广州建站快车
  • 东莞哪里能学建设网站给个网站最新的2021
  • 网站开发专业培训免费小程序制作平台
  • wordpress网站主机名编辑网站
  • 做网站用虚拟主机怎么样硬件开发平台是什么意思
  • 用python做的网站多吗化妆品公司网站源码
  • 兰州企业网站株洲优化公司
  • 前端网站开发百度网站怎么做信息
  • 建站快车用户登录小程序询价表
  • 织梦网站管理系统做机械设备网站
  • 网站开发的选题审批表仿爱奇艺网站源码
  • 做零食用哪个网站好网站备案跟域名有什么关系
  • 农庄网站模板不要验证码的广告网站
  • 珠海公司网站制作做网站用php转html
  • 北京网站排名北京住房与城乡建设网站
  • 最超值的锦州网站建设做销售有什么技巧和方法
  • 蒲县网站建设有什么网站可以做团购
  • 帝国网站后台管理系统五大跨境电商平台对比分析
  • 在柬埔寨做网站彩票推广怎么找推广平台
  • 如何建设自己的网站来获取流量哪里做网站百度收录块
  • 临海门户网站住房和城乡建设规划局成都互联网公司排名
  • 郑州网站推广公司价格新手小白如何互联网创业
  • 网站右侧浮动导航域名转移 网站访问
  • 广州网站开发方案重庆设计公司招聘
  • 企业网站内容模块网站建设后台功能
  • 网站空间购买哪个好北京最近确诊病例轨迹
  • 我的世界服务器网站建设html学校网站模板
  • 北京专业网站建设公司哪家好电子商务具体干嘛的
  • 珠江网站建设郑州做优化的公司有哪些